For ten years, Making a Baby has been the definitive source for couples who want to get pregnant, offering vital information on fertility technology, advances in baby-boosting medications, and cutting-edge medical techniques. Written with compassion and clarity, and now with even more tips on the best ways to prepare the body to get pregnant, this invaluable book, in a newly revised and updated edition, reveals how to protect, increase, and extend your fertility. Inside you'll find
• The four basic requirements for reproduction.
• Findings from the Harvard Nurses' Health Study that explain dietary ways to boost fertility.
• Breakthrough information connecting insulin levels with ovulation.
• Updates on the importance of marine omega-3 fatty acids in your baby's development.
• Groundbreaking pregnancy advice for women over 35.
• News about polycystic ovary syndrome-and the recommended fertility drugs that may temporarily override this condition and boost chances of conception.
• What every man should know about his long-term reproductive health, including the most recent findings on male infertility.
This detailed, insightful, and meticulously researched book will help guide you to a wonderful new beginning as a parent!
